Accounting Specialist

Twin Rivers Paper Company, headquartered in Madawaska, Maine, is an integrated specialty paper manufacturer producing 400,000 tons of paper per year for the packaging, publishing, label, and technical sectors. With 100 years of papermaking history, the company operates a pulp mill in New Brunswick, and diverse paper assets in northern Maine and upstate New York that produce uncoated and coated white papers in a broad range of basis weights and finishes.

Customized product development and dedicated technical services support are company hallmarks. With a sound financial structure and a strong balance sheet that fuels continuous investments in its assets, Twin Rivers Paper offers its customers the security of local product availability through a strong, domestically owned manufacturer and the assurance of long-term viability.

Reporting to the VP of Finance, the Accounting Specialist is responsible for the fiduciary responsibilities of finance, monthly closing and reporting for the Company.

Responsibilities:

  • Ensuring accounting requirements are completely accurate and on time
  • Documents and substantiates financial transactions by entering account information
  • Analyzes operational and financial data, investigating variances, identifying business drivers, and evaluating their impact on planned objectives
  • Prepares meaningful variance analysis commentary for management
  • Consolidates cost reduction and other continuous improvement activities
  • Provides assistance in reporting against performance targets in incentive programs
  • Assists with the recommendation, development, and implementation of process improvements in support of the operating agenda

Requirements:

  • BA in Accounting or Finance
  • Strong skill in the areas of analysis, problem-solving, organization, multi-tasking, prioritization, communication, and relationship building
  • Ability to think strategically in a constantly changing business environment and market
  • Ability to operate with high regard to integrity, trust, and confidentiality
  •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Word and Microsoft Outlook.

Working Conditions:

The Accounting Specialist spends 100% of the time in an office environment entering and analyzing data, preparing and reviewing reports, working with internal departments and external systems support, and attending meetings.
